
The first 600 ℃ high temperature liquid metal shield pump in China was successfully developed in Lanzhou University of technology
Recently, the first 600 ℃ high-temperature liquid lead bismuth alloy transmission shield pump in China, designed by Dr. Cheng Xiaorui of the school of energy of Lanzhou University of technology and manufactured by Dalian Sifang electric pump Co., Ltd., has been successfully developed. It has been delivered to the Institute of modern physics of the Chinese Academy of Sciences for test operation, and the relevant technical indicators fully meet the requirements. The successful development of the product fills the gap in China.
Lead bismuth alloy, also known as low temperature alloy, or low melting point alloy, or fusible alloy. It is mainly composed of lead and bismuth with low melting point, and other metals are added to adjust the melting point of the alloy. The fourth generation advanced nuclear power system lead based fast reactor is a fast neutron reactor with molten metal lead or lead bismuth alloy as coolant. It adopts closed fuel cycle and can operate under normal pressure and high temperature. Lead based fast reactor has excellent fuel conversion capacity, which can effectively improve the utilization rate of uranium and thorium resources and greatly improve the sustainability of fuel. It can also be used to incinerate long-lived actinides in the spent fuel of existing light water reactor, so as to make cleaner use of nuclear energy. High temperature liquid lead bismuth alloy transfer pump is the key core equipment of the primary circuit of a new miniaturized nuclear reactor.
